Intrauterine Fetal Goiter: Diagnosis and Management
Summary: Objective: The diagnosis and management of a fetal neck mass encountered during routine antenatal ultrasound screening, and later diagnosed definitely as a intrauterine fetal goiter, is discussed in this case report. Case Report: A 28-year-old primigravida at 36 weeks' gestation with n...
